2) Когда надо чтоб быстрее работало и по другому никак, то и не такое
можно использовать.

    Да ? По другому никак ? Ошибаешьсся

Я вобще-то не утверждал что по другому никак. Тема где должна быть логика избитая. Логика на триггерах - это вариант, имеющий право на жизнь.

    Ой, только не надо мне рассказывать про "сложность" обхода триггера,
имея соотв. права.

Я не про то как обойти, а про защиту от дурака.

    Сложно ???

Нет, не сложно. Рутина просто.

    И где ты нашёл, что INSTEAD OF триггер в MSSQL не отменяет оригинальное
действие ?

Твои слова. Ты триггеры BEFORE/AFTER делаешь аналогами INSTEAD OF в MS SQL?

Дальше твои слова:

    А бага-то где ? Али ты не в курсе, что OLD и NEW в AFTER триггерах
read-only ?

К сожалению в MS SQL нету NEW и OLD, но думаю что если бы они там были, то триггер INSTEAD OF не запрещал бы туда пичать что-то.


Так кто они, эти триггеры AFTER на представление? Да и вобще, какое AFTER может тогда быть если сам момент операции не определён?

Ответить